A lava lamp contains a mixture of colored paraffin wax andanother compound that makes the solid was just a bit denser thanthe clear liquid (usually mineral oil or water) in the lamp. Theheat is supplied by a light bulb below the sealed glass bottle ofthe lamp. There is a wire heating coil in the bottom of the sealedbottle to help transfer heat energy into the wax. The top and sidesof the sealed glass bottle are cooler than its heated base.
